This position is no longer available.

Software engineer Ruby On Rails - Freelance

Freelance
Paris
Salary: Not specified
Starting date: January 31, 2021
Fully-remote

Wecasa
Wecasa

Interested in this job?

Questions and answers about the job

The position

Job description

We are developpers with high technical expectations, from various backgrouds, all based in France at the moment.
Wecasa has a strong technical culture, with a high need for automatisation. We have a strong focus on automated test which made our paltform very robust and nearly bug free. We use machine learning algorithms to find the best fit between custoemrs and professionals, and our Rails application handles all the transaction workflow (even if our monolithic architecture will have to be migrated to a micro-services architecture in the future).

We are particularly committed to our users satisfaction, both our clients and our professionnals. This satisfaction is reflected in our business metrics: Wecasa has a growth of +20% / month over the past 18 months.

We work daily with passionnate collegues of very different roles. In addition to the interactions with the product team, we collaborate with marketing, customer care, B2B relationship, data sciences, etc.

YOUR MISSIONS

Along with Julien, CTO & cofounder and Romain, Lead dev Ruby, you actively participate in the development of our marketplace, in collaboration with Elsa our Product Manager and Anne-Emilie our Designer :

  • Features development for :

    • our customers (e.g. ability to tip professionals, support for duo massage)
    • our professionnals (e.g. geolocalisation)
    • our customer service team (better admin interface, integration of third partiy tools)
  • API definition and implementation for our front applications (web or mobile), in collaboration with Sébastien our Lead Dev Front (e.g. choosing the API format standard, now in REST, to be migrated if pertinent)

OUR TECHNICAL STACK

Backend: Ruby on Rails 5 / MySQL / Redis / Sidekiq
Frontend: Sass / Haml / Bootstrap 4 / ES5 / jQuery (migrating to React) + 2 mobile apps (React Native)
Numerous API used: Stripe, Twilio, Google Maps, Slack, Zoho…
Code Quality with Rspec, Capybara, Rubocop (CI on CircleCI)
Git versioning, systematic code reviews and preproduction testing
Hosting: Ubuntu server at OVH, to be migrated to Google Cloud or AWS
Agile methodology, using Trello and Slack

WHAT WE HAVE TO OFFER

Freelance position, fully remote
Salary: Competitive rates
Availability: ASAP
2000€ budget to choose your material


Preferred experience

Rails developper with several years or relevant work experience (international applicants are welcome)

YOUR QUALIFICATIONS
✓ Ruby on Rails expertise
✓ Qualifications in integration (HTML5, SCSS, Bootstrap) or in DevOps
✓ Knowledges in Linux system administration or in React (JS ou Native) would be nice to have
✓ Interest and abilities to learn and share your knowledges


Recruitment process

1) Interview with lead developer
2) Technical test
3) Debrief with 2 developers from the team on the test
4) Final interview with one of our co-founders

Want to know more?

These job openings might interest you!

These companies are also recruiting for the position of “Software & Web Development”.